Last year, on the twelve days before and after Christmas, I wrote a little Xmas tale each day and texted it to my partner, Katie, as a gift. It was an impulsive decision and a challenge to myself that ended up being the most fun I had writing in a while.
This year, we turned those stories into a 44-page zine with collages made by Katie to accompany the stories.

If you’re a fan of seasonal humor and shenanigans, I hope you’ll pick up a copy. It can only be found in a few places: The Future Tense Books website, Antiquated Future, Powell’s, Up Up Books, and Mother Foucault’s, where I’ll be reading for the release party on Friday December 12th.
